How Common Is The Last Name Caravette? popularity and diffusion

The surname Caravette is the 2,034,059th most frequently held last name worldwide, borne by around 1 in 85,735,834 people. The surname Caravette occurs mostly in The Americas, where 100 percent of Caravette are found; 89 percent are found in North America and 89 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

This last name is most frequent in The United States, where it is held by 76 people, or 1 in 4,769,196. In The United States Caravette is most frequent in: Illinois, where 87 percent are found, Florida, where 12 percent are found and Wisconsin, where 1 percent are found. Excluding The United States Caravette occurs in 2 countries. It is also common in Brazil, where 6 percent are found and Argentina, where 5 percent are found.
